How to Sign Your Daily Reports in Raken

In this article, learn how to sign and complete your daily reports in Raken from the web app and mobile app.

Signing your daily report is the final step that officially closes out the day — creating a legally defensible, timestamped record of all field activity. Once signed, reports are automatically distributed to your configured email recipients.


Quick Answer

To sign a daily report, open the project's daily log for the day, click or tap the orange Sign button, draw your signature, and confirm.


How to Sign a Report on the Web

Step 1: Open the Project and Navigate to Daily Logs

Log into the Raken Web App. Click Projects in the left side navigation bar and select your project. Click Daily logs in the left side project menu.

Step 2: Select the Date to Sign

Use the date navigation to select the day. Verify the report is complete before signing.

Step 3: Sign the Report

Click the orange Sign button in the top right corner. Draw your signature in the box using your mouse.

Step 4: Complete

Check Save signature to save it for future use. Click the orange Complete button to finalize.

Note: If the Sign button is greyed out, the report needs at least one entry. Add a quick note, then click Sign.

Step 5: View or Share the Signed Report

Click the Reports button and select Daily to view the signed PDF. Use Email report to share it.


How to Sign a Report on Mobile

Step 1: Open the Project

Open the Raken mobile app and tap your project.

Step 2: Navigate to the Daily Log

Tap Daily logs in the Project tools grid and navigate to the day you want to sign.

Step 3: Preview and Sign

Tap Preview report, then tap Sign and complete at the bottom of the screen.

Step 4: Draw Your Signature

Use your finger to sign. Check Save signature to save it for future use.

Step 5: Complete

Tap Complete to finalize. Tap View signed report to see the finished PDF.


Troubleshooting & FAQ

The Sign button is greyed out — why?

Raken requires at least one entry before a report can be signed. Add a note, work log, or any other entry, then the Sign button will become active.

I signed the wrong day — can I undo it?

Yes. Open the signed report and click or tap the Unsign button to remove the signature.

Will signing send the report to recipients automatically?

Yes — if you have email recipients configured under Settings > Daily Reporting > Recipients. Recipients set to on sign receive it immediately.

Can someone else sign on my behalf?

Any team member with sign permissions on the project can sign. Account Admins and Project Admins have sign permissions by default.


Technical Specifications

  • Compatibility: iOS 15+, Android 12+, and all major web browsers

  • Offline Capability: No — signing requires an active connection

  • Plan Required: All plans

  • Role Required: Account Administrator or Project Administrator with sign permissions


Considerations

  • Signing a report finalizes it for that date. Verify entries are complete before signing.

  • Reports can be unsigned at any time if a correction is needed.

  • Consistent signing ensures a complete, auditable daily record for every project day.
